10 Essential Desk Accessories to Transform Your Workspace
Revamping your workspace can significantly enhance both productivity and comfort. The right desk accessories can create an organized and inspiring environment. Here are 10 essential desk accessories that can transform your workspace:
- Desk Organizer: Keep your essentials such as pens, papers, and sticky notes neatly arranged.
- Ergonomic Chair: Invest in a chair that offers support and promotes good posture for long hours of work.
- Monitor Stand: Elevate your screen to eye level to reduce neck strain.
- Mouse Pad: Choose one that offers wrist support for comfortable navigation.
- Desk Lamp: Adequate lighting can prevent eye strain during late-night work sessions.
- Whiteboard: Useful for jotting down ideas, reminders, and deadlines.
- Plants: Incorporate greenery to boost your mood and purify the air.
- Noise-Canceling Headphones: Block out distractions and enhance your focus.
- Cable Management Solutions: Tame your cords for a cleaner look.
- Inspirational Decor: Add art or quotes that motivate you to stay engaged in your work.

How to Organize Your Desktop for Maximum Creativity
Organizing your desktop is crucial for enhancing your creativity and productivity. A cluttered space can lead to a cluttered mind, making it difficult to focus on the tasks at hand. Start by evaluating your current setup and removing any unnecessary items or files that may distract you. Consider implementing a 'minimalist' approach where only essential tools and resources are visible. Create designated areas for specific tasks, whether it’s for inspiration, brainstorming, or execution. Organizing your digital files into clearly labeled folders can also streamline your workflow, ensuring that you spend less time searching for documents and more time creating.
Once you've cleared the excess from your space, it’s time to optimize it for creativity. Utilize colors and themes that inspire you, incorporating art or motivational quotes that speak to your personal vision. Adjust your workspace to allow for natural light and comfortable seating, as these factors can greatly enhance your mood and focus. Finally, consider using tools like a whiteboard or sticky notes to keep your ideas visible and accessible. By customizing your environment to reflect your unique style and needs, you’ll cultivate a space that keeps your creative juices flowing and your mind clear.
Can Your Workspace Affect Your Creativity? Here's What the Research Says
Numerous studies suggest that your workspace can significantly affect your creativity. For instance, a study published in the journal Environmental Psychology found that factors such as lighting, color, and organization of a workspace can either stimulate or hinder creative thinking. Bright natural lighting and vibrant colors are associated with increased energy and creative output, while cluttered or dark spaces may lead to feelings of stress and confinement. Therefore, optimizing your workspace could serve as a catalyst for enhanced creativity.
Moreover, the design of your workspace plays a pivotal role in fostering creative thinking. Research indicates that flexible office spaces that allow for movement and collaboration can lead to greater innovation among teams. In contrast, traditional cubicle farms may stifle creative exchange. As a result, considering factors like ergonomics and aesthetic appeal is essential not only for comfort but also for nurturing a creative mindset. Ultimately, the right workspace can be a game-changer in unlocking your full creative potential.
